Keep Bearings Lubed Without Tear-Down: E-Z Lube Compatible Cap

Greasing your bearings doesn’t have to mean pulling the whole hub apart. The included E-Z Lube-compatible grease cap gives you direct access to the zerk fitting on your spindle. Just remove the rubber plug, attach the grease gun, and inject fresh grease—it flows through to both bearings. This keeps water and dirt out while preventing corrosion inside the hub housing.

Set Up Once, Fit Right Every Time: Standard #84 Spindle Dimensions

The hub is engineered for 3,500-lb axles using #84 spindles, making it straightforward to match with common replacement parts. The inner bearing has a 1.378" inner diameter and the outer bearing measures 1.063". Combined with a grease seal inner diameter of 1.719" and a 5 on 4-3/4" bolt pattern, everything lines up cleanly for an exact fit with 13"–15" wheels.

Determining Bolt Pattern

1. Count the lug holes

Look at the wheel hub or the back of the wheel and count how many lug holes there are(also called bolt holes).

Common configurations include: 4-lug, 5-lug, 6-lug and 8 lug

2a. For even lug counts (4-lug, 6-lug, 8-lug)

Measure from the center of one lug hole directly across to the center of the hole opposite it.

Center to Center
Common configurations: 4 on 4", 6 on 5.5", 8 on 6.5"

2b. For odd lug counts (5-lug)

Measure from the center of one lug hole to the outer edge of the hole directly across (not center-to-center since there's no directly opposite hole).

Center to Outside Edge
Common configurations: 5 on 4.5" (most popular), 5 on 5", 5 on 4.75", 5 on 5.5"

  • How to Determine the Correct Replacement Hub
    In order to find the correct replacement hubs for your trailer, you need to know the weight rating of your axle, and also what bearings your current hub has. You will need to take apart your current hub assembly and look at the bearings themselves; wipe away the grease and you should be able to see the part number stamped directly on them. If you are unable to find them, you need to use a digital caliper and measure your spindle to the thousandths of an inch where the bearings and grease...

  • Bearing Part Numbers and Spindle Dimensions for Selecting New Hubs
    If you want to switch out the hubs what you need to do is find the bearing and seal part numbers from the original hubs. Any new hub must use the same bearings and seals as the original in order for it to fit properly on your spindles. Examples of those parts numbers are show in the linked image. You can instead measure the spindles but those measurements need to be very precise, and to the nearest thousandth of an inch, like 1.234-inches. You will need a digital caliper like # PTW80157...
